staging: usbip: bugfix for deadlock

Interrupts must be disabled prior to calling usb_hcd_unlink_urb_from_ep.
If interrupts are not disabled, it can potentially lead to a deadlock.
The deadlock is readily reproduceable on a slower (ARM based) device
such as the TI Pandaboard.
